During a phone call, the leader of the United States, Donald Trump, informed President of Ukraine Volodymyr Zelensky that the Russian dictator Vladimir Putin does not want a ceasefire.
Journalist Barak Ravid reported this on social media X on Saturday, August 16.
Putin does not want a truce
The news spread that the US leader shared rather alarming information with the Ukrainian president - Vladimir Putin is not seeking a truce. This could have serious consequences for the situation in eastern Ukraine and for the geopolitical situation in the region as a whole.
